What’s wrong with offensive play?
That’s a question we all ask. Scoring goes down. Big plays are down. Bags are up. Quarterbacks getting shaken up is an every Sunday thing.
The reason is simple. Offensive line play stinks. Usually we see that in the first two weeks of the season, but it continued this week and affected the offenses again. Just sitting in our green room watching every game, it seemed like a quarterback was either getting sacked, beaten or running for his life on almost every play.
Offensive lines don’t hit much in the summer, which is why they’re bad right now. The defensive linemen are so athletic that it takes work to prepare for all their stunts and looks. When you combine that with all the external coverages, it’s a problem. Quarterbacks are accelerated by the fronts, but slowed by the rear aspects.
Until the offensive line play improves, expect it to stay that way. They don’t hit enough in the summer, that’s why we see the offensive disorders every week in the NFL. This week was no different.
They’re not hitting, so their quarterbacks are paying the price.
Now for some more quick observations from Week 3:
- I may be wrong about Titans quarterback Will Levis. I thought he would take a big step forward this year, but so far he has been a disaster. Three straight games with bad turnovers with Sunday’s pick-six by Jaire Alexander in the Titans’ loss to the Packers. He’s another guy victimized by terrible offensive line play, but he needs to be better. I know he wasn’t even a starter for a full season, but I expected a lot more. How much patience will new coach Brian Callahan have with Levis? It can’t be much. Deservedly so.
- Brian Flores is a defensive wizard. The Vikings are 3-0 because of his defense. That unit dominated CJ Stroud and the Texans on Sunday in a blowout win. Stroud finished 20 of 31 for 215 yards, one touchdown and two picks, but it looked a lot worse than that. He was sacked four times by the Vikings when Flores threw so many different looks at him. It’s time Flores gets another look as a head coach. He will be much better the second time around.
- The Steelers are 3-0 and Mike Tomlin is showing why he is in the conversation every year to be the best coach in the league. I thought the Steelers would be the worst team in the division. They are the best. They do it with a good defense and solid quarterback play from Justin Fields, who threw for 245 yards with a touchdown in Pittsburgh’s 20-10 win over the Chargers. The Steelers had five sacks on the day they knocked Justin Herbert out of the game. He came in with a bad ankle and left after re-injuring it. Moreover, Fields must remain as the starter. There should be no debate about it.
- The Seahawks are 3-0 and have looked good at times on both sides of the ball. But they beat a rookie quarterback in his first start in Week 1, needed overtime to beat a bad Patriots team in Week 2 and then beat the Tua Tagovailoa-less Dolphins on Sunday. Next week is the Lions on Monday night. We’ll know more about the Seahawks after that one.
- The cowboys are in serious trouble. The defense is bad and that puts too much pressure on the offense. Mike Zimmer was brought in to anchor the defense, but the run defense remains a major problem. The Ravens ran for 274 yards on Sunday in their 28-25 win. That kind of run defense demoralizes a team. They are not big and they are pushed. Something has to change.
- Raiders coach Antonio Pierce saying some Raiders “made business decisions” late in the team’s loss to the Panthers. That means they give up. The film session will be fun this week. Pierce won’t hold back — nor should he.
- The Packers won two games with Malik Willis at quarterback — and he played well. But that defense really impressed Sunday with a pick six by Jaire Alexander and eight sacks with seven players receiving at least half. The hiring of Jeff Hafley as defensive coordinator was a great move.
- How good is Giants rookie Malik Nabers? He had two touchdowns on his eight catches for 78 yards. One of those was outstanding with a big foot tap to put his feet up for the score. He is special.
- Jalen Hurts’ game-winning drive for the Eagles against New Orleans will put to rest all the talk of Eagles coach Nick Sirianni being in trouble. The Eagles beat the Saints 15-12 when Hurts hit a big play to Dallas Goedert to set up the game-winning touchdown. The Eagles were staring 1-2 in the face until he made the big throw on third-and-16 to Goedert, who had a monster day. Now at 2-1, the Eagles lead the division when they go to play the Bucs next week.
- Speaking of the Bucs, what the hell was that against the Broncos? They were flat and clearly outclassed in burst loss. That’s not a good look after beating the Lions on the road. Baker Mayfield was extraordinary for much of the game, but the depleted defense was even worse.
- Sean McVay can level coach. If we didn’t know that already, we saw it on Sunday when his gritty team battled back from 14 down to beat the 49ers. The play calling was excellent, but so was his fake throw for a first down, which started the team in the third quarter. McVay gets it.
- We saw the real Aaron Rodgers again last Thursday. After two so-so games, Rodgers looked like MVP Rodgers against the Patriots. His throws were accurate, the ball was on target but the biggest thing was his ability to move to throw. He looked hesitant the first two games coming off his torn Achilles. But Rodgers looked like Rodgers again against the Pats, which is why the Jets are a Super Bowl challenger
- The Patriots need to go ahead with it and play rookie Drake Maye. Sure, the offensive line isn’t good, but let’s forget all the talk about ruining a quarterback’s psyche if he gets beat up too much. A great myth. If that happens, you drafted the wrong guy. Don’t tell me about David Carr with the Texans either. He was just the wrong guy. Play Drake Maye. If not this week against the 49ers on the road, which isn’t happening, then do it next week against the Dolphins at home.
require.config({“baseUrl”:”https://sportsfly.cbsistatic.com/fly-0782/bundles/sportsmediajs/js-build”,”config”:{“version”:{“fly/components/accordion”:”1.0″,”fly/components/alert”:”1.0″,”fly/components/base”:”1.0″,”fly/components/carousel”:”1.0″,”fly/components/dropdown”:”1.0″,”fly/components/fixate”:”1.0″,”fly/components/form-validate”:”1.0″,”fly/components/image-gallery”:”1.0″,”fly/components/iframe-messenger”:”1.0″,”fly/components/load-more”:”1.0″,”fly/components/load-more-article”:”1.0″,”fly/components/load-more-scroll”:”1.0″,”fly/components/loading”:”1.0″,”fly/components/modal”:”1.0″,”fly/components/modal-iframe”:”1.0″,”fly/components/network-bar”:”1.0″,”fly/components/poll”:”1.0″,”fly/components/search-player”:”1.0″,”fly/components/social-button”:”1.0″,”fly/components/social-counts”:”1.0″,”fly/components/social-links”:”1.0″,”fly/components/tabs”:”1.0″,”fly/components/video”:”1.0″,”fly/libs/easy-xdm”:”2.4.17.1″,”fly/libs/jquery.cookie”:”1.2″,”fly/libs/jquery.throttle-debounce”:”1.1″,”fly/libs/jquery.widget”:”1.9.2″,”fly/libs/omniture.s-code”:”1.0″,”fly/utils/jquery-mobile-init”:”1.0″,”fly/libs/jquery.mobile”:”1.3.2″,”fly/libs/backbone”:”1.0.0″,”fly/libs/underscore”:”1.5.1″,”fly/libs/jquery.easing”:”1.3″,”fly/managers/ad”:”2.0″,”fly/managers/components”:”1.0″,”fly/managers/cookie”:”1.0″,”fly/managers/debug”:”1.0″,”fly/managers/geo”:”1.0″,”fly/managers/gpt”:”4.3″,”fly/managers/history”:”2.0″,”fly/managers/madison”:”1.0″,”fly/managers/social-authentication”:”1.0″,”fly/utils/data-prefix”:”1.0″,”fly/utils/data-selector”:”1.0″,”fly/utils/function-natives”:”1.0″,”fly/utils/guid”:”1.0″,”fly/utils/log”:”1.0″,”fly/utils/object-helper”:”1.0″,”fly/utils/string-helper”:”1.0″,”fly/utils/string-vars”:”1.0″,”fly/utils/url-helper”:”1.0″,”libs/jshashtable”:”2.1″,”libs/select2″:”3.5.1″,”libs/jsonp”:”2.4.0″,”libs/jquery/mobile”:”1.4.5″,”libs/modernizr.custom”:”2.6.2″,”libs/velocity”:”1.2.2″,”libs/dataTables”:”1.10.6″,”libs/dataTables.fixedColumns”:”3.0.4″,”libs/dataTables.fixedHeader”:”2.1.2″,”libs/dateformat”:”1.0.3″,”libs/waypoints/infinite”:”3.1.1″,”libs/waypoints/inview”:”3.1.1″,”libs/waypoints/jquery.waypoints”:”3.1.1″,”libs/waypoints/sticky”:”3.1.1″,”libs/jquery/dotdotdot”:”1.6.1″,”libs/jquery/flexslider”:”2.1″,”libs/jquery/lazyload”:”1.9.3″,”libs/jquery/maskedinput”:”1.3.1″,”libs/jquery/marquee”:”1.3.1″,”libs/jquery/numberformatter”:”1.2.3″,”libs/jquery/placeholder”:”0.2.4″,”libs/jquery/scrollbar”:”0.1.6″,”libs/jquery/tablesorter”:”2.0.5″,”libs/jquery/touchswipe”:”1.6.18″,”libs/jquery/ui/jquery.ui.core”:”1.11.4″,”libs/jquery/ui/jquery.ui.draggable”:”1.11.4″,”libs/jquery/ui/jquery.ui.mouse”:”1.11.4″,”libs/jquery/ui/jquery.ui.position”:”1.11.4″,”libs/jquery/ui/jquery.ui.slider”:”1.11.4″,”libs/jquery/ui/jquery.ui.sortable”:”1.11.4″,”libs/jquery/ui/jquery.ui.touch-punch”:”0.2.3″,”libs/jquery/ui/jquery.ui.autocomplete”:”1.11.4″,”libs/jquery/ui/jquery.ui.accordion”:”1.11.4″,”libs/jquery/ui/jquery.ui.tabs”:”1.11.4″,”libs/jquery/ui/jquery.ui.menu”:”1.11.4″,”libs/jquery/ui/jquery.ui.dialog”:”1.11.4″,”libs/jquery/ui/jquery.ui.resizable”:”1.11.4″,”libs/jquery/ui/jquery.ui.button”:”1.11.4″,”libs/jquery/ui/jquery.ui.tooltip”:”1.11.4″,”libs/jquery/ui/jquery.ui.effects”:”1.11.4″,”libs/jquery/ui/jquery.ui.datepicker”:”1.11.4″}},”shim”:{“liveconnection/managers/connection”:{“deps”:[“liveconnection/libs/sockjs-0.3.4″]},”liveconnection/libs/sockjs-0.3.4”:{“exports”:”SockJS”},”libs/setValueFromArray”:{“exports”:”set”},”libs/getValueFromArray”:{“exports”:”get”},”fly/libs/jquery.mobile-1.3.2″:[“version!fly/utils/jquery-mobile-init”],”libs/backbone.marionette”:{“deps”:[“jquery”,”version!fly/libs/underscore”,”version!fly/libs/backbone”],”exports”:”Marionette”},”fly/libs/underscore-1.5.1″:{“exports”:”_”},”fly/libs/backbone-1.0.0″:{“deps”:[“version!fly/libs/underscore”,”jquery”],”exports”:”Backbone”},”libs/jquery/ui/jquery.ui.tabs-1.11.4″:[“jquery”,”version!libs/jquery/ui/jquery.ui.core”,”version!fly/libs/jquery.widget”],”libs/jquery/flexslider-2.1″:[“jquery”],”libs/dataTables.fixedColumns-3.0.4″:[“jquery”,”version!libs/dataTables”],”libs/dataTables.fixedHeader-2.1.2″:[“jquery”,”version!libs/dataTables”],”https://sports.cbsimg.net/js/CBSi/app/VideoPlayer/AdobePass-min.js”:[“https://sports.cbsimg.net/js/CBSi/util/Utils-min.js”]},”map”:{“*”:{“adobe-pass”:”https://sports.cbsimg.net/js/CBSi/app/VideoPlayer/AdobePass-min.js”,”facebook”:”https://connect.facebook.net/en_US/sdk.js”,”facebook-debug”:”https://connect.facebook.net/en_US/all/debug.js”,”google”:”https://apis.google.com/js/plusone.js”,”google-csa”:”https://www.google.com/adsense/search/async-ads.js”,”google-javascript-api”:”https://www.google.com/jsapi”,”google-client-api”:”https://accounts.google.com/gsi/client”,”gpt”:”https://securepubads.g.doubleclick.net/tag/js/gpt.js”,”hlsjs”:”https://cdnjs.cloudflare.com/ajax/libs/hls.js/1.0.7/hls.js”,”recaptcha”:”https://www.google.com/recaptcha/api.js?onload=loadRecaptcha&render=explicit”,”recaptcha_ajax”:”https://www.google.com/recaptcha/api/js/recaptcha_ajax.js”,”supreme-golf”:”https://sgapps-staging.supremegolf.com/search/assets/js/bundle.js”,”taboola”:”https://cdn.taboola.com/libtrc/cbsinteractive-cbssports/loader.js”,”twitter”:”https://platform.twitter.com/widgets.js”,”video-avia”:”https://vidtech.cbsinteractive.com/avia-js/2.12.0/player/avia.min.js”,”video-avia-ui”:”https://vidtech.cbsinteractive.com/avia-js/2.12.0/plugins/ui/avia.ui.min.js”,”video-avia-gam”:”https://vidtech.cbsinteractive.com/avia-js/2.12.0/plugins/gam/avia.gam.min.js”,”video-avia-hls”:”https://vidtech.cbsinteractive.com/avia-js/2.12.0/plugins/hls/avia.hls.min.js”,”video-avia-playlist”:”https://vidtech.cbsinteractive.com/avia-js/2.12.0/plugins/playlist/avia.playlist.min.js”,”video-ima3″:”https://imasdk.googleapis.com/js/sdkloader/ima3.js”,”video-ima3-dai”:”https://imasdk.googleapis.com/js/sdkloader/ima3_dai.js”,”video-utils”:”https://sports.cbsimg.net/js/CBSi/util/Utils-min.js”,”video-vast-tracking”:”https://vidtech.cbsinteractive.com/sb55/vast-js/vtg-vast-client.js”}},”waitSeconds”:300});